TEACHING STAFFS

Appointments, Transfers ahd Resignations H.B. EDUCATION AREA The following appointments and transfers are announced by the Hawke's Bay Education Board, and take effect from February 1, 1938: — Appointments. — Miss C. L. Ashcroft, Dannevirke North; Mr A. W. Bird, Dannevirke North; Mr G. J. Goldsinan, Dannevirke South; Mr H. A. Jensen> Kaiti; Mr G. A. Read, Kopuawhara; Mr (J. G. Warren, Korokoro; Miss F. J. Bullen, Maharahara; Miss L. O; Pleming, Motuhora; Mr O. E. Johnston^ Napier Intennediate; Mr R. D. Thompson, Otane; Miss K. C. Bullen, Patutahi; Miss 1. G. Dent, Rere; Mr R. Short, Te Hupara; Mr L. T. Armslrong^ Tfe Uii; Miss ti. H. Whitta, Woodville. Transfers. — Miss E. A. Wheeler, Hastings West to Clive; Miss M. E. O 'Hara-Smith, Dannevirke North to Dannevirke South; Miss M. J. Elie, Putorino 10 Hastings West; Mr G. li. E. Vigis, Kaiti to Mangapapa; Mr J. Cowan, Korokoro to Pakowhai; Miss M. E. Mace, Opoutama to Poukawa; Mr O. T. Leggett, Kopuawhara to Te Eehunga; Mr A. A. Brown# Pakowhai to Waerenga- a-hika. The following resignations from members of the teaching staffa were receivOd: — Mr J. H. Martin, Gisborne Central; Miss I. E. Curry, Mahora; Miss C. Kippengerger. Puha; Miss M. J. Gould, "Woodville.
